What is the full form of IMPS?

IMPS, which stands for Immediate Payment Service is a revolutionary interbank electronic funds transfer system in India. Launched by the National Payments Corporation of India (NPCI), IMPS allows you to transfer funds instantly and securely through mobile banking, internet banking, or even ATMs.

Is IMPS faster or RTGS?

NEFT transactions are processed in half-hourly batches and can take up to a few hours to complete. RTGS transactions are processed individually and are usually completed within a few minutes. On the other hand, IMPS allows for real-time funds transfer, ensuring instant transactions.

What is the limit of IMPS in SBI?

SBI IMPS Transaction Limits

The maximum limit per transaction is ₹5,00,000. The total limit for daily transfers is ₹25,00,000, allowing you to make multiple transactions throughout the day, as long as the total does not exceed this amount.

How to refund an IMPS payment?

In case the IMPS transaction is not completed for any reason - technical or business, the reversal of the remitter funds will happen immediately. If such a transaction becomes a subject matter of reconciliation wherein the fate of transaction is not determined immediately, the reversal of funds will happen in T+1 days.
